PowerDesigner与UML建模应用
一、 PD 简介 PowerDesigner 是一个集所有现代建模技术于一身的完整工具,它集成了强有力的业务建模技术、传统的数据库分析和实现,以及UML对象建模。通过了元数据的管理、冲突分析和真正的企业知识库等功能。 利用它可以制作数据流程图、概念数据模型、物理数据模型 帮助企业 快速高效 地进行企业应用 系统构建 及再工程(Re-engineer)。 IT专业人员可以利用它来有效开发各种解决方案,从定义业务需求到分析和设计,以至集成所有现代 RDBMS 和Java、.NET、PowerBuilder和 Web Services的开发等。 PDM定义了模型的物理实现细节。例如,所选RDBMS的数据类型特征、索引定义、视图定义、存储过程定义、触发器定义等。 二、数据完整性的分类 实体完整性 主键约束 唯一键约束 域的完整性 非空约束 检查约束 默认值约束 引用完整性: 外键约束 定义索引 定义视图 定义存储过程 三、创建PDM 1、约束的创建 2、定义视图与索引 3、定义存储过程 四、数据库的操作 连接数据库 (ODBC方式) 产生数据库或者脚本 (Sql 语句方式与ODBC方式) 同步数据库 (ODBC方式) 产生脚本数据 执行sql脚本 选择Database-> Configure Data Connections 选择Database-> Connect 选择数据源